I don't know why this is happening but whenever i logon to Windows XP with networking Available i get a popup box on the Welcome screen. Here are the details:

-There is no title.
-The close (X) button is greyed out
-There is no information or content showing in the dialog window(Blank Box)
-There are two buttons (YES) and (NO)

I clicked on (NO) and now my internet Connection through my network is unavailable, I can connect through a modem (Which is what i am doing now).

I have not clicked (YES) because iam unsure of what will happen. I have run a Virsu Scan on my computer using up-to-date Virus definitions through Norton AntiVirus Pro 2004, and no threat is displayed, i have a firewall activated.

Can someone shead some light on what is happening to my computer.
